Abstract
The invention relates to a wave type intermittent driving ready-made garment hanging assembly line structure which is formed by connecting a plurality of work stations end to end; an original main track and a transmission mechanism are eliminated, so that the assembly line structure is simplified; through cooperation of a lifting mechanism and gravity, wave type intermittent driving propulsion of hangers is realized, therefore, energy is saved greatly. According to the assembly line, all working procedures are carried out in sequence, if one working procedure is low in efficiency, the phenomenon of backlog occurs immediately, and workers are urged to improve the working efficiency to reduce backlog, so that the problem that partial workers laze in the conventional assemble line is solved well.
